Age UK Maidstone manage a number of centres and services which aim to help older people to improve their own wellbeing and promote independence.
The Mill Street office in Maidstone (ME15 6XW) offers a wide range of wheelchairs for hire.
The Maidstone Community Support Centre (ME14 1HH) offers help at home (cleaning, laundry, changing bedding, shopping, gardening); help with bathing in your own home; help with property maintenance; a monthly lunch club and cafe; support for people living with dementia and those looking after them; counselling; hearing clinic; footcare; music; dance; sing-along; quizzes; computer classes; seated exercise and Nintendo Wii sessions and art therapy sessions.
The Goodman Centre (ME15 6XW) in Bearsted is a fully equipped, safe and homely place for people living with dementia. Transport to and from the Centre is available upon request.
The West Kent befriending project aims to provide support and companionship to adults to reduce loneliness and isolation. The project is suitable for the elderly, people living with physical impairments and mental illness. The project operates in Dartford, Gravesham, Maidstone, Sevenoaks, Tonbridge and Tunbridge Wells.
